    1. Chlorine does not kill ALL micro-organisms in water

    2. Chlorine is pH dependant

    3. Chlorine is corrosive

    4. Chlorine is hazardous to transport, store and use

    5. Chlorine does not effectively remove the bio-film & algae.

    6. Chlorine generates by-products that are a proven andpermanent risk for human health.

    The dosing capacity of 1 Liter Diamondoxide is calculated as

    following:

    Diamondoxide0.45% = 4,5 gram ClO2 per liter = 4500 ppm/mg perliter

    1 liter ofDiamondoxide can disinfect:

    at 0.02 ppm dosing= 4500 ppm/0.02 ppm = 225.000 liter of water.at 0.10 ppm dosing= 4500 ppm/0.10 ppm = 45.000 liter of water.

    orVolume of water to be disinfected x dosage rate = ClO2

    4500 ppm
